You're correct that the OP was talking about Swap with the Pot and I got focused on personal drops. My bad. But, swap with the pot is not affected by APD holidays either. The formula in 23.v.5 is what produces the reserves required shown in DBMS. If the available is greater than the required that's all the system looks at. PWA 23.H says nothing about a swap with the pot being able to be denied if the trip to be dropped operates on an APD holiday. Only a carryout trip, i.e. asterisk rotation, can be affected if the carryout portion hits an APD holiday. Again, my bigger point is that the only thing an APD holiday can cause to not be granted is an APD. As long as reserves available is greater than reserves required they can't deny a PD or SWP simply due to an APD holiday period.
